Probably the only thing that you can't change to be like 2007 is the command manager and the position of the feature tree. Those are pretty much stuck where they are. You can turn off all of the menu choices for the command manager. As for the icon RMB menus, those can be turned off in the TOOLS CUSTOMIZE menu under the box CONTEXT TOOLBAR SETTINGS. You can customize the HUD in the top center of the graphics window. Even the dumb a$$ crinkled paper can get changed back. Why they chose to use this as a default drawing paper is childish.
